		<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The poor traffic quality from Entrecard is a result of people dropping simply to earn credits.  So, if they wanted to increase the quality of traffic you get from adverts, then they&#8217;d have to get rid of the &#8220;dropping&#8221; portion of the site.  Instead, they could simply be a banner exchange program, where you still earn credits for selling adverts.  Of course the traffic would go wayyy down, but who cares, you&#8217;re only losing the &#8216;drop &amp; run&#8217; traffic anyways, which doesn&#8217;t count for diddly.</p>
